Can you mail tax extension?

You can file an extension for your taxes by submitting Form 4868 with the IRS online or by mail. This must be done by the tax filing due date. Filing an extension for your taxes gives you additional months to prepare your return no matter the reason you need the extra time.

What is the tax extension deadline for 2021?

The federal income tax filing deadline is May 17, 2021. If you need more time, you can get an automatic income tax extension by filing IRS Form 4868. This gets you until Oct. 15, 2021, to file your tax return.

Will the IRS extend the tax deadline in 2021?

In response to the Coronavirus (COVID-19) pandemic, the Treasury and IRS issued new guidance that calls for a tax deadline extension, moving the customary April 15 deadline to May 17, 2021.

How do I file a tax extension automatically?

You can get an automatic extension of time to file your tax return by filing Form 4868 electronically. You’ll receive an electronic acknowledgment once you complete the transaction. Keep it with your records. Don’t mail in Form 4868 if you file electronically, unless you’re making a payment with a check or money order.

What happens if I miss tax deadline?

The penalty you will pay for not filing on time is 5% of your unpaid taxes for each month your return is late, with a maximum penalty of 25%. For each month you don’t pay, the IRS charges. 5%, and up to 25%. Penalties can add up to almost 50% of your tax bill.

What happens if you miss your tax extension deadline?

If you miss the tax extension deadline, you’ll incur penalties that are retroactive to your original tax due date (usually April 15). Remember, you must pay your taxes by the tax deadline or you’ll incur penalties. You can request to pay your taxes in installments with an IRS payment plan.
